Brucella ovis mutant in ABC transporter protects against Brucella canis infection in mice and it is safe for dogs
BACKGROUND/OBJECTIVES: Vaccination is the most important tool for controlling brucellosis, but currently there is no vaccine available for canine brucellosis, which is a zoonotic disease of worldwide distribution caused by Brucella canis.
